Leaving another review after brow lift, lower blepharoplasty, and fat grafting

Time is going by well after the brow lift, lower blepharoplasty, and fat grafting^^ It has been a while since I wrote my first review, and the residual swelling and the firm feeling around the eye area that were left from the previous month have now completely disappeared. The fat seems to have settled in smoothly without any awkwardness.

As I got older, my biggest concern was that my lower eyelids sagged and my upper eyelids drooped, making my eyes look pressed down. The asymmetrical eye feeling was also severe, so my expression looked cramped, and because I had little facial fat, hollow cheeks and even the curve of my forehead stood out into a peanut-shaped face, so I was really often told I looked tired. Now, thanks to the brow lift, the tension on my eyelids is gone, so I can open my eyes comfortably without using my forehead muscles. With the lower blepharoplasty, the puffiness and shadow under my eyes have been improved, so even bare-faced the dark feeling around my lower face and eye area has been reduced a lot. The uneven eye line also seems to have been corrected into stable symmetry. I had quietly worried that the fat grafting might look too much, but after the excess swelling went down, only the right amount remained, so it looks natural haha.

When I went to a gathering recently, my friends also said my facial lines looked much more relaxed and healthy. I thought recovery would be quite long because I had three surgeries at once, but thanks to Dr. Hwang of Modern Aesthetics adjusting everything so it would not be excessive for my face, the operated areas seem to blend naturally as time passes. The tight and uncomfortable feelings I had at the beginning have all disappeared now, so I feel like I made the right choice to do them all at once rather than separately haha.
